Clinical Manager - Richmond Road A
- Growth Ortho (Lexington, KY)
-
POSITION DESCRIPTION Position: Clinical Manager Richmond Rd Department: Clinical Reports To: Senior Clinical Leadership FLSA Status: Exempt SCOPE The Clinical Manager supervises clinical and clerical staff, including Team Leads (clinical, clerical, and MRI), serves as the onsite Training Officer for all clinic locations. And is responsible for overseeing all clinical and clerical staff within the Richmond Road A building. This role requires strong leadership, operational oversight, and a commitment to ensuring that patients receive the highest standard of care. The Clinical Manager will coordinate daily operations, support staff performance, and ensure compliance with organizational policies and regulatory requirements. KEY RESPONSIBILITIES & DUTIES Clinical Support · Manage and supervise all clinical staff within the Richmond Road A building. · Maintain and adjust clinical schedules to support efficient patient flow. · Support patient care functions as needed. Administrative and Clerical Support · Manage and supervise all clerical staff within the Richmond Road A building. · Manage daily operations to ensure efficient workflow and an exceptional patient experience. · Lead hiring, onboarding, and training processes for both clinical and clerical staff. · Partner with leadership on departmental initiatives, projects, and operational improvements. · Approve and manage timesheets for assigned staff. · Support administrative operations as needed. Documentation and Data Management · Assist with reporting requirements such as MIPS. · Support EMR documentation practices and ensure team adherence to organizational documentation standards. Additional Expectations · Ensure facility compliance with OSHA standards and all applicable healthcare regulations. QUALIFICATIONS & REQUIREMENTS Education and Experience: · Associate’s degree in nursing, Business Administration, Healthcare Administration, or a related field preferred. · Experience in clinical operations, medical office workflow, or supervisory roles strongly preferred. SKILLS Leadership Skills · Demonstrated leadership and team-building skills. · Ability to train, coach, and evaluate staff performance. Administrative and Technical Skills · Strong organizational and time-management abilities. · Commitment to regulatory and safety compliance. Interpersonal and Communication Skills · Excellent written and verbal communication. Clinical Skills / Operational Knowledge · Understanding of all clinical and clerical roles within the building. Other · Performs all other duties as assigned. JOB KNOWLEDGE · Microsoft Office Suite · EMR/PMS systems; Greenway Intergy preferred · OSHA regulations · MIPS reporting · Healthcare compliance standards PHYSICAL REQUIREMENTS · Good visual acuity, hand-finger dexterity, and ability to speak and hear clearly. · Ability to lift, carry, push, and pull up to 25 pounds or more, utilizing a full range of body movements as needed. · Ability to stand, walk, stoop, kneel, crouch, reach, and grasp for extended periods. · Prolonged periods of sitting at a desk and working on a computer. · Ability to assist patients safely and effectively as needed. SCHEDULE This is an hourly position, typically Monday through Friday, 8:00 AM to 5:00 PM. Employees may be required to work extended hours, including evenings or weekends, as necessary to meet patient and clinic needs. Occasional adjustments to scheduled hours may be required based on provider schedules or clinical demands.
